Keto Cookies and Cream Mousse Recipe: Low-Carb Delight!


  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up heavy whipping cream
  • 4 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 1/3 cup powdered erythritol (or preferred keto sweetener)
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 tbsp un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1/4 cup crushed keto-friendly cookies (or homemade almond flour-based cookies)
  • Sugar-free dark chocolate shavings (optional for garnish)

Instructions

Step 1: Prepare the Base

  • In a mixing bowl, beat the cream cheese until smooth and fluffy.
  • Add the powdered erythritol and vanilla extract, then continue mixing until well incorporated.

Step 2: Whip the Cream

  • In a separate bowl, whisk the heavy whipping cream until stiff peaks form.
  • Gently fold the whipped cream into the cream cheese mixture, ensuring a light and airy texture.

Step 3: Add the Cookies

  • Fold in the crushed keto cookies to evenly distribute them throughout the mousse.

Step 4: Assemble and Chill

  • Spoon the mousse into serving glasses or bowls.
  •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ow flavors to meld and texture to firm up.

Step 5: Garnish and Serve

  • Sprinkle with additional cookie crumbles and sugar-free dark chocolate shavings for an extra touch of decadence.
  • Serve chilled and enjoy!

Notes

  • Chocolate Lovers’ Version – Add extra cocoa powder to the mousse base for a richer chocolate flavor.
  • Nutty Delight – Fold in chopped toasted almonds or pecans for added crunch.
  • Dairy-Free Option – Use coconut cream instead of heavy cream and a dairy-free cream cheese substitute.
  • Protein Boost – Mix in a scoop of keto-friendly vanilla or chocolate protein powder.
